diff options
Diffstat (limited to 'modules/upnp')
-rw-r--r-- | modules/upnp/SCsub | 6 | ||||
-rw-r--r-- | modules/upnp/doc_classes/UPNP.xml | 2 | ||||
-rw-r--r-- | modules/upnp/register_types.cpp | 4 | ||||
-rw-r--r-- | modules/upnp/upnp.cpp | 6 | ||||
-rw-r--r-- | modules/upnp/upnp.h | 6 | ||||
-rw-r--r-- | modules/upnp/upnpdevice.cpp | 4 | ||||
-rw-r--r-- | modules/upnp/upnpdevice.h | 2 |
7 files changed, 21 insertions, 9 deletions
diff --git a/modules/upnp/SCsub b/modules/upnp/SCsub index cde231867f..2b15f7aee2 100644 --- a/modules/upnp/SCsub +++ b/modules/upnp/SCsub @@ -25,8 +25,12 @@ if env['builtin_miniupnpc']: ] thirdparty_sources = [thirdparty_dir + file for file in thirdparty_sources] - env_upnp.add_source_files(env.modules_sources, thirdparty_sources) env_upnp.Append(CPPPATH=[thirdparty_dir]) env_upnp.Append(CPPFLAGS=["-DMINIUPNP_STATICLIB"]) + env_thirdparty = env_upnp.Clone() + env_thirdparty.disable_warnings() + env_thirdparty.add_source_files(env.modules_sources, thirdparty_sources) + +# Godot source files env_upnp.add_source_files(env.modules_sources, "*.cpp") diff --git a/modules/upnp/doc_classes/UPNP.xml b/modules/upnp/doc_classes/UPNP.xml index 30be9c836b..b98327c60d 100644 --- a/modules/upnp/doc_classes/UPNP.xml +++ b/modules/upnp/doc_classes/UPNP.xml @@ -69,7 +69,7 @@ </argument> <description> Discovers local [UPNPDevice]s. Clears the list of previously discovered devices. - Filters for IGD (InternetGatewayDevice) type devices by default, as those manage port forwarding. [code]timeout[/code] is the time to wait for responses in miliseconds. [code]ttl[/code] is the time-to-live; only touch this if you know what you're doing. + Filters for IGD (InternetGatewayDevice) type devices by default, as those manage port forwarding. [code]timeout[/code] is the time to wait for responses in milliseconds. [code]ttl[/code] is the time-to-live; only touch this if you know what you're doing. See [enum UPNPResult] for possible return values. </description> </method> diff --git a/modules/upnp/register_types.cpp b/modules/upnp/register_types.cpp index c79155c4d2..13088c94dd 100644 --- a/modules/upnp/register_types.cpp +++ b/modules/upnp/register_types.cpp @@ -29,7 +29,9 @@ /*************************************************************************/ #include "register_types.h" -#include "error_macros.h" + +#include "core/error_macros.h" + #include "upnp.h" #include "upnpdevice.h" diff --git a/modules/upnp/upnp.cpp b/modules/upnp/upnp.cpp index 32fdfe22f8..69e054f5c5 100644 --- a/modules/upnp/upnp.cpp +++ b/modules/upnp/upnp.cpp @@ -29,8 +29,10 @@ /*************************************************************************/ #include "upnp.h" -#include "miniupnpc/miniwget.h" -#include "upnpcommands.h" + +#include <miniupnpc/miniwget.h> +#include <miniupnpc/upnpcommands.h> + #include <stdlib.h> bool UPNP::is_common_device(const String &dev) const { diff --git a/modules/upnp/upnp.h b/modules/upnp/upnp.h index fb0c0f30a0..8f0a972c22 100644 --- a/modules/upnp/upnp.h +++ b/modules/upnp/upnp.h @@ -31,9 +31,11 @@ #ifndef GODOT_UPNP_H #define GODOT_UPNP_H -#include "miniupnpc/miniupnpc.h" +#include "core/reference.h" + #include "upnpdevice.h" -#include <reference.h> + +#include <miniupnpc/miniupnpc.h> class UPNP : public Reference { diff --git a/modules/upnp/upnpdevice.cpp b/modules/upnp/upnpdevice.cpp index a5959cf649..8f935fbd82 100644 --- a/modules/upnp/upnpdevice.cpp +++ b/modules/upnp/upnpdevice.cpp @@ -29,8 +29,10 @@ /*************************************************************************/ #include "upnpdevice.h" + #include "upnp.h" -#include "upnpcommands.h" + +#include <miniupnpc/upnpcommands.h> String UPNPDevice::query_external_address() const { ERR_FAIL_COND_V(!is_valid_gateway(), ""); diff --git a/modules/upnp/upnpdevice.h b/modules/upnp/upnpdevice.h index 25c9fe1ba3..e4c5eb691d 100644 --- a/modules/upnp/upnpdevice.h +++ b/modules/upnp/upnpdevice.h @@ -31,7 +31,7 @@ #ifndef GODOT_UPNPDEVICE_H #define GODOT_UPNPDEVICE_H -#include <reference.h> +#include "core/reference.h" class UPNPDevice : public Reference { |